Late Night Collision on E 17th St in Grand Island, NE
Grand Island, NE (July 1, 2026) – At least one person was hurt on Wednesday night, July 1, after an accident on East 17th Street in Grand Island.
Emergency units arrived after the 10:22 p.m. report and helped those involved. Authorities have not yet confirmed the total number of people injured or the extent of their injuries.
The
Grand Island Police Department is reviewing what caused the wreck and may release more information as it becomes available.

What Should You Avoid After a Collision in Grand Island, NE?
You should avoid leaving without getting help, skipping medical care, guessing about fault, or giving rushed statements after a collision in Grand Island. These choices can make the process harder later. Clear records can help show what happened and how the injuries affected you.
Once you get medical care, avoid ignoring pain that appears later. Some injuries feel minor at first, then become more noticeable with time. Follow-up visits, treatment notes, and bills can help show how your recovery developed after the accident.
Before you speak with an insurance company, gather the records tied to the accident. These may include medical notes, photos, bills, and any report number available. Reviewing those details first can help you avoid giving incomplete answers that create confusion later.

If you were hurt, avoid posting detailed comments online about your injuries or what you think happened. Insurance companies may review public posts during a claim. It is safer to focus on medical care, records, and confirmed facts while the process moves forward.
